| Item 1.02. | Termination of a Material Definitive Agreement. |
Merger Agreement Termination
As previously disclosed, on July 29, 2025, Verisk Analytics, Inc., a Delaware corporation (the “Company”), entered into an Agreement and Plan of Merger (as amended, restated or otherwise modified from time to time, the “Merger Agreement”) by and among the Company, Lenny Merger Sub, Inc., a Delaware corporation and an indirect, wholly owned subsidiary of the Company (“Merger Sub”), ExactLogix, Inc., a Delaware corporation d/b/a AccuLynx.com (“ExactLogix”), and Richard Spanton, Jr., an individual, solely in his capacity as representative of the equityholders of ExactLogix thereunder (the “Equityholders’ Representative”), pursuant to which, among other things, and subject to the satisfaction or waiver of the conditions set forth in the Merger Agreement, Merger Sub was intended to merge with and into ExactLogix, with ExactLogix surviving as a wholly owned subsidiary of the Company (the “Merger”).
On November 21, 2025, the Company exercised its right, pursuant to Section 9.1(f) of the Merger Agreement, to extend the termination date under the Merger Agreement to December 26, 2025.
On December 26, 2025, the Company delivered a notice to ExactLogix and the Equityholders’ Representative terminating the Merger Agreement because the Merger was not consummated on or before December 26, 2025.
Subsequently, on December 26, 2025, ExactLogix notified the Company that it believes the Company’s termination of the Merger Agreement is invalid. The Company strongly disagrees with this assertion and intends to vigorously defend against any such assertions.

Term Facility Termination
As previously reported on August 15, 2025 the Company entered into a Term Credit Agreement (the “Term Credit Agreement”), among the Company, the lenders party thereto and Bank of America N.A., as administrative agent. The Term Credit Agreement provided for a senior unsecured three-year delayed draw term loan facility in an aggregate principal amount of $750,000,000 (the “Term Facility”).
Pursuant to Section 2.06 of the Term Credit Agreement, the Term Facility automatically terminated on December 26, 2025.

| Item 8.01. | Other Events. |
On December 29, 2025, the Company notified Computershare Trust Company, N.A. as successor to Wells Fargo Bank, N.A., as Trustee, that, in connection with the termination of the Merger Agreement, it will redeem, (1) $750,000,000 in aggregate principal amount of its 4.500% Senior Notes due 2030 (the “2030 Notes”) in full at the special mandatory redemption price, equal to 101% of the principal amount plus accrued and unpaid interest to the redemption date and (2) $750,000,000 in aggregate principal amount of its 5.125% Senior Notes due 2036 (the “2036 Notes,” together with the 2030 Notes, the “Notes”) in full at the special mandatory redemption price, equal to 101% of the principal amount plus accrued and unpaid interest to the redemption date. The Company expects that the special mandatory redemption date for the Notes will be January 6, 2026. This Current Report on Form 8-K is not a notice of redemption for the Notes.
